For the forth time, Cuban cigar smoker Jose Castelar Cueto has entered Guinness Book of Records. This time previous his records Jose has eclipsed by appearance of 45 meters long cigar. It is the longest cigar made on Cuba and that entered Guinness Book of Records. For obvious reasons nobody will be able to smoke such cigar but in return you can enjoy to the full the sight you will see.

Cuban hasn’t grudged time for making his brainchild and has spent 50-60 hours a week to make giant cigar. Necessary measurements have been made and have been carried cigar analyzes after what “Guinness Book of Records” commission has approved new record. On May 6th, 2009 Cueto has received from hands of Cuban Tourism minister Manuel Marrero diploma. Thid document officially confirms that Cueto already for the forth time got in the list of record holders. “For me, personally, this is an honor as I represent Cuban tobacco Sellers” – 65 years old Cueto who manufacturers cigars for 50 years already (from being 15 years old) told.

Now in Cueto plans is to make cigar that will have length of Havana’s avenue Maleon that is 7 kilometers long.
